com.sap.idm.provisioning.engine dependency
The standard provisioning engine com.sap.idm.provisioning.engine of SAP IdM is used as a dependency for the ROIAM CONNECTOR. If the SAP IdM implementation does not use this provisioning engine, the import of the ROI iAM connector package will fail. To fix this, you will need to re-link the respective processes to the customized provisioning engine package. If you are unsure about the steps required to achieve this, contact the ROIABLE support team.
ROIABLE Accelerator Tracing
The traces and logs of the accelerator are available like any other application running on SAP NetWeaver, within the Log Viewer in the SAP NetWeaver Administrator user interface. If they are not visible, you may need to change the criticality of the tracing location of com.roiable.roiam.idmproxy. SAP’s official documentation provides more details about the configuration of the log — Log Configuration with SAP NetWeaver Administrator
Recommendation
Use the debug tracing level only when needed (e.g., more log data is required) — for example, during initial setup, when connecting to a new system, or when the result of a manual action is unclear. The SAP NetWeaver system may experience higher loads if the debug level is left enabled for extended periods.
All accelerator messages start with the prefix ROI iAM debugger, which can be used to filter and identify the logs. The trace files can then be provided to the ROI iAM support team for analysis if they are too technical to interpret.
